So bummed / do you think there is any hope still?

So I just got a letter saying that I don't qualify for unemployment because

1 - I did not earn wages in at least 2 calendar quarters of my base period
2- The total wages of my base period are less that 1.5 times the total wages for the highest quarter earnings in your base period

So for context, I stared a job in November last year, and was fired mid June this year. I was first sent a letter saying that I did not qualify because they only had my wage info for 1 BASIC BASE QUARTER 10/1 – 12/31, and I filed for reconsideration using the ALTERNATE BASE QUARTER option 1/1 - 3/31, and supplied the wage information of the rest of time leading up to my termination. But just got a letter saying that I still don't quality, stating the 2 reasons I listed above.

I was just looking on the FAQ page, and had a little glimmer of hope and saw this:

If you do not qualify in any of these base periods,
AND
You worked for pay in the calendar quarter when you filed,
AND
You are still unemployed after that quarter ends,
AND
You think that you may qualify using the latest work,
THEN
You should file a claim again for benefits after this calendar quarter ends.
Please note:
Once you use wages to establish a claim, they are void for the next claim. You cannot use them again. This may affect your entitlement to a later claim.

So does this mean I can reapply, since we are now in August, and I am indeed still unemployed. Or does this note:

Once you use wages to establish a claim, they are void for the next claim. You cannot use them again. This may affect your entitlement to a later claim.

mean that I can't qualify because I've already used these wages on this claim? Which fucking sucks and seems so unfair :,(
